Web1. Honesty. Integrity and honesty go together, and neither can exist without the other. The example of honesty and integrity translates into being open with your colleagues and peers without taking advantage of either. WebJul 21, 2024 · Here's what you can do to demonstrate your work ethic during recruitment and at work: 1. Continuously improve the quality of your work. Committing to self-improvement activities shows that you're dedicated to strengthening your skills and want to perform well on the job.
